Options While Composing a Message 1. While composing a message, press the Menu Key to reveal additional messaging options. • Attach: Add an attachment to the message. Options are: - Slideshow: Create up to a 10 slide slideshow to attach to the message. - Pictures: Opens your Gallery of photos. Touch an existing photo to attach it to your message. - Videos: Opens your Gallery of videos. Touch an existing video to attach it to your message. - Audio: Opens the My Files app. Navigate to a music or audio file. Touch the circle to the right of the audio file to turn it green, then touch OK. - Capture picture: Opens the Camera app so you can take a new photo and attach it to your message by touching Save. - Capture video: Opens the Camera app in video mode so you can record a video, review the video, and attach it to your message by touching Save. - Record audio: Opens the Voice Recorder app so you can record a new audio clip and attach it to your message by touching Menu Key ➔ Add. - Contacts: Opens your contacts list so you can touch an existing contact and attach the contact's name and telephone number to your message by touching OK. - Calendar: Displays existing Calendar events so you can touch an event to attach it to your message. - Memo: Displays your existing memos so you can touch one or more memos to attach them to your message by touching OK. • Add text: Copy text from your contacts, your calendar, or a memo to add to your message. This is a convenient feature for adding names, phone numbers, events, and so on, to your message. For more information, refer to "Adding Additional Text" on page 98. • Insert smiley: Add emoticons, such as a happy face, to your message. The emoticon is inserted in the text where the cursor is positioned. • Discard: Delete the message without saving it to your Drafts folder. Adding Additional Text You can copy text such as names, phone numbers, and events from your Contacts, Calendar, or a Memo. 1. While composing a message, press the Menu Key ➔ Add text. 2. At the Add text screen, select one of the following: • Contacts: Displays your contacts list so you can touch an existing contact and check mark the contact information you want to add to your message by touching Add. • Calendar: Displays existing Calendar events so you can touch an event to add event name, date, and time to your message.
